We successfully demonstrated a polarization insensitive 100 GHz-spaced 16-channel multiplexer with a polarization dependent wavelength shift of 0.01 nm. © 2001 Optical Society of America PDF Article More Like This Arrayed waveguide gratings (AWG) are commonly used as optical (de)multiplexers in wavelength division multiplexed (WDM) systems. These devices are capable of multiplexing many wavelengths into a single optical fiber, thereby increasing the transmission capacity of optical networks considerably. WebAs with most optical devices, it is highly desirable for AWGs to have low loss, especially for low power applications. Typical losses include fiber-to-chip coupling loss, material loss, bending loss, waveguide scattering loss, and the transition loss between the FPR (free propagation region) and the arrayed waveguides.
